"Semi-official" vest with gold rank badges center front and back. It is decorated with embroidery on blue satin ground with mandarin squares. There is an applied knotted net, tassels and metal bangels. It has pink damask lining. There is a crane in the mandarin square located in the center, with cranes, peacocks and egrets underneath, all on a black background. It is decorated with dragons and mountain formations and diagonal multicolored waves below, which are surrounded by peaches and bats in clouds. It has silk net and tassels located around the lower hem.
